Background
The water soluble fertilizer containing high concentration humic acid is a humic acid full water soluble fertilizer which can be completely dissolved in water, can be quickly dissolved in water, is easier to be absorbed by crops, has relatively high absorption and utilization rate and less comprehensive nutrition and dosage, is a quick-acting fertilizer which can be quickly and effectively used for liquid or solid fertilizer for irrigation fertilization, foliar fertilization, soilless culture, seed soaking and root dipping and the like after being dissolved or diluted by water.

Preferably, the driving mechanism comprises a driving motor, a driving shaft and a transmission toothed plate, the driving motor is embedded and installed on the top wall surface of the machine body, the driving shaft is fixedly installed at the output end of the driving motor, and the transmission toothed plate is fixedly installed on the driving shaft.
Preferably, a movable shaft is movably mounted in the machine body corresponding to the connecting plate, an extrusion bump is fixedly mounted at the bottom of the movable shaft, and the transmission toothed plate is respectively in meshing transmission with the adjusting shaft and the movable shaft.
As preferred, there is the (mixing) shaft inside the stirring storehouse through motor movable mounting, and fixed mounting has the base on the (mixing) shaft, and four puddlers have been seted up to the equidistance on the lateral wall of base.
Preferably, four the equal fixed mounting in the one end that the puddler kept away from each other has the scraper blade, and the one end wall face that the (mixing) shaft was kept away from to the scraper blade is laminated with the inner wall in stirring storehouse mutually.
Preferably, two of the opposite scrapers are provided with stirring grooves.

The first embodiment is as follows: a stirring device for producing a water-soluble fertilizer containing high-concentration humic acid is shown in figures 1-3 and comprises a machine body 1, a grinding bin 2 is arranged above the interior of the machine body 1, the grinding bin 2 is a groove with a rectangular structure, a stirring bin 3 is arranged at the middle position in the machine body 1, the stirring bin 3 is a groove with a cylindrical structure, a feed inlet 7 communicated with the interior of the grinding bin 2 is arranged at the top of the machine body 1, the feed inlet 7 is an opening with a rectangular structure, a grinding seat 8 is fixedly arranged at the bottom of the interior of the grinding bin 2, the grinding seat 8 is of a trapezoidal structure, a grinding plate 9 is movably arranged above the interior of the grinding bin 2, a movable groove 18 is arranged at the left side of the interior of the machine body 1, and the movable groove 18 is a groove with a rectangular structure, one end of lapping plate 9 is located the inside of movable groove 18, the inside left side of fuselage 1 offer with the inside spread groove 11 that communicates in stirring storehouse 3, spread groove 11 is the groove of rectangle structure, the inside movable mounting of spread groove 11 has first sealed piece 12, the inside movable mounting of spread groove 11 has regulating spindle 21, movable mounting is inlayed downwards to regulating spindle 21 inside and the 12 threaded connection of first sealed piece 12, silo 10 has been seted up down between spread groove 11 and the grinding storehouse 2, the rectangular channel that silo 10 was seted up on the slant left side, the inside top fixed mounting in grinding storehouse 2 has triangular plate, the inside of fuselage 1 is provided with the actuating mechanism that drives lapping plate 9 and the removal of first sealed piece 12.
Actuating mechanism is including driving motor 13, drive shaft 14, transmission pinion rack 15, driving motor 13 inlays the top wall of installing at fuselage 1, drive shaft 14 is cylindrical structure, drive shaft 14 fixed mounting is at driving motor 13's output, transmission pinion rack 15 is circular structure, transmission pinion rack 15 fixed mounting is on drive shaft 14, the inside of fuselage 1 corresponds the position movable mounting of connecting plate 19 has loose axle 16, loose axle 16 is cylindrical structure, the bottom fixed mounting of loose axle 16 has extrusion lug 17, extrusion lug 17 is the water droplet shape structure, transmission pinion rack 15 meshes the transmission with regulating shaft 21 and loose axle 16 respectively.
There is (mixing) shaft 4 inside the stirring bin 3 through motor movable mounting, and (mixing) shaft 4 is cylindrical structure, and fixed mounting has base 5 on (mixing) shaft 4, and four puddlers 6 have been seted up to the equidistance on the lateral wall of base 5, and puddler 6 is the pole of rectangle structure.
Example two: on the basis of the first embodiment, as shown in fig. 1 and fig. 3, the scrapers 24 are fixedly mounted at the ends of the four stirring rods 6 far away from each other, the scrapers 24 are plates with a rectangular structure, the wall surface of one end of each scraper 24 far away from the stirring shaft 4 is attached to the inner wall of the stirring bin 3, wherein a plurality of stirring grooves 25 are formed in two opposite scrapers 24, and each stirring groove 25 is a groove with a rectangular structure.
